Transaction 253af53da77abef1742c6f11ff7a2aeeeca5331b711516b44a1602fae28000dc

2 Input
2 Outputs
  • 253af53da77abef1742c6f11ff7a2aeeeca5331b711516b44a1602fae28000dc:0
  • value  249370
    address  14p4dezAGaq8kPmshnafjWfqw2dLb72tKs
  • 253af53da77abef1742c6f11ff7a2aeeeca5331b711516b44a1602fae28000dc:1
  • value  1073873
    address  3JVDgbvfH449E3Di2qXiQRfs7PuzRziqGC